Rep is a bold, wide-ranging podcast, brought to you by journalist Noor Tagouri. Noor began by examining the misrepresentation of Muslims in US media and how this impacts American culture. She discovered a fuller exploration of the ever-evolving story of America, which challenged the stories we’ve known…and revealed how the stories we tell affect all of us. Rep is a thoughtful investigation of our beliefs and understandings and how they exist within the dynamic of politics, pop culture, and public opinion.

Featuring Egyptians around the world who fuel creative social change and their journeys that brought them there. From the intersection of Egyptian identity and creative social change: stories from street to sound.

The Egyptian Streets Podcast

Bassem Youssef - Reinvention, Political Satire and a Plant Based Diet (February 2021)

Felukah - New York and Cairo, Storytelling, and Rap (May 2021)

Rosaline Elbay - Ramy, British Theatre and Archaeology (January 2021)

Deena Mohamed - Shubeik Lubeik, Qahira and Graphic Novels in Egypt (January 2021)

Amir El-Masry - Limbo, Studying Criminology, and a British-Egyptian Identity (April 2021)

This is a story of the experience of Arab Americans in the U.S. I interview Rehab Morsi, and her son Hussein Mohamed, about their experience for the past 20-something years in the U.S. I also interview Iraqi-American Playwright Heather Raffo who contextualizes the Arab-American experience from her point of view.

From Cairo to Brooklyn: The Arab American Experience (April 2020)

Palestinian Female filmmakers are at an interesting intersection in the film industry, this documentary tells the story of what threats face the Palestinian film industry in this day and age.

Shooting Under the Occupation: A Story of Palestinian Film (December 2019)
